
La Ode Alfin Haris Munandar, S.Pd., M.Pd.
La Ode Alfin Hris Munandar, M.Pd., is a lecturer in the Department of English Education within the Faculty of Teacher Training and Education at Universitas Mataram. He holds a master’s degree from the English Education Graduate Program at the same university. Prior to joining Universitas Mataram, he actively participated as a member of the Association of Indonesian Tours and Travels Agencies (ASITA). Through his experience in the field of tours and travel, he has developed a strong research interest in Tourism Discourse, Culture, Identity, and Intercultural Communication. Currently, as a lecturer in the Department of English Education, La Ode Alfin teaches courses including Academic Vocabulary and Corpus in the Department of English Education, as well as English for Specific Purposes (ESP) in the Faculty of Economics and Business, Faculty of Law, and Faculty of Mathematics and Natural Sciences. His teaching seamlessly integrates with his research pursuits, which encompass areas such as Classroom Discourse, Student and Teacher Identity, Professional Development, and the Analysis and Development of Textbooks. Beyond the classroom, La Ode Alfin actively contributes to academic conferences and workshops, and collaborating with fellow lecturers to advance the field of education and promote interdisciplinary research.
